andrew Black wrote:
I want to create repeated chords (in a piano part).
I have tried
<c e g>*4
but this gives "unexpected *".
Is the * notation only applicable to full bar rests (eg R1*4).
No, but it is only applicable to durations, i.e. you can say
<c e g>1*4 just as well as c4*4, however it's not what you
want. For example, c4*4 will print a quarter note but otherwise
the note will be treated like a whole note.
Rather, you may want to look at Section "6.7.7 Measure repeats"
in the manual.
